Output dd96aac74054dced33bcac76955eeb03160beb9da18b7ce3487f4a0d253bdaf8:1

value
2905770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3028250a5094fd4ba0f9ed5f119aa28d7e1c7aa OP_EQUAL
address
3KU8hHK5Smhtuwmrn3YiUggybPzatquQZd
transaction
dd96aac74054dced33bcac76955eeb03160beb9da18b7ce3487f4a0d253bdaf8
spent
true